Understanding AI Publishing Services for Startups

AI publishing services leverage machine learning algorithms to automate content creation, distribution, and optimization. These tools analyze market trends, audience preferences, and SEO data to generate articles, blog posts, and marketing copy that align with business objectives. For startups and SMBs, this technology reduces the need for large content teams while maintaining quality and relevance. The global AI in publishing market is projected to reach $1.2 billion by 2027, growing at a CAGR of 24.5% from 2022 to 2027, according to a 2025 ITIF report. This growth reflects increasing adoption among resource-constrained businesses seeking scalable content solutions. AI publishing platforms typically integrate with CMS systems, email marketing tools, and social media APIs, enabling seamless content deployment across channels. Startups must evaluate whether these services align with their brand voice and strategic goals before implementation.

Core Features and Functionalities

Modern AI publishing services offer several key capabilities that address startup needs. Content generation tools use large language models to produce draft articles based on prompts, keywords, or topic clusters. These systems can create 500-1000 words per minute with accuracy rates exceeding 85% for standard business content. Automated SEO optimization analyzes keyword density, meta descriptions, and heading structures to improve search visibility. Content personalization engines segment audiences to deliver tailored messaging based on user behavior and demographics. Performance analytics track engagement metrics like time-on-page, bounce rates, and conversion funnels to refine content strategies. A 2024 Gartner survey found that 68% of SMBs using AI publishing tools reduced content production costs by 30-50% within six months. These features collectively enable startups to maintain consistent publishing schedules without proportional cost increases.

Cost Structures and Pricing Models

Pricing for AI publishing services varies significantly based on functionality and scale. Entry-level plans typically start at $99 per month for basic content generation with limited templates and SEO features. Mid-tier options range from $299 to $799 monthly, offering advanced customization, multi-language support, and team collaboration tools. Enterprise solutions can exceed $2,000 monthly with dedicated model training, API access, and priority support. A 2025 TechCrunch analysis noted that 72% of startups prefer subscription models over one-time purchases due to predictable budgeting. However, startups must calculate ROI by comparing AI costs against traditional content production expenses. For example, hiring a full-time content writer costs $50,000-$70,000 annually, while AI services at $300/month equate to $3,600 yearly – a 93-95% cost reduction. This financial efficiency makes AI publishing particularly attractive for capital-constrained SMBs.

Implementation Steps for Startups

Adopting AI publishing requires a structured approach to ensure success. First, startups should audit existing content needs and identify high-impact use cases like blog posts, social media updates, or email campaigns. Next, they must select a platform that integrates with their current tech stack, such as WordPress or HubSpot. Pilot testing with a small content volume (e.g., 10-20 pieces) allows evaluation of quality and workflow compatibility. Training staff on platform features typically takes 2-4 hours per user according to vendor data. A 2024 case study by ContentAI showed that startups implementing AI publishing saw a 40% faster content cycle time after initial setup. Critical success factors include defining clear quality control protocols and allocating budget for human editing to maintain brand consistency.

Evaluating Alternatives and Common Pitfalls

Startups often make three critical mistakes when adopting AI publishing services. First, they assume AI eliminates human oversight entirely, leading to generic or factually incorrect content. A 2023 Stanford study found that 22% of AI-generated business content contained significant factual errors requiring manual correction. Second, many overlook integration challenges; 41% of SMBs reported compatibility issues with their existing CMS platforms in a 2024 Gartner survey. Third, startups frequently underestimate the need for prompt engineering – poorly crafted inputs yield subpar outputs. To avoid these pitfalls, businesses should allocate 15-20% of their AI budget for human editing and invest time in crafting precise prompts. Comparing platforms reveals key differentiators: some excel at long-form content (e.g., Jasper AI for whitepapers) while others specialize in short-form social media copy (e.g., Anyword for ad variations). Startups should prioritize platforms offering transparent pricing and robust support channels.

When to Act and Strategic Considerations

Startups should implement AI publishing services when content demands exceed team capacity or when scaling rapidly. Indicators include publishing more than 15 pieces weekly or needing real-time performance optimization. However, businesses must assess content complexity – AI struggles with highly technical or creative work requiring deep domain expertise. A 2025 McKinsey report noted that AI publishing adoption is highest in SaaS, e-commerce, and media startups, where content volume and speed are critical. Companies should also consider data privacy regulations; platforms must comply with GDPR and CCPA, especially for EU-based startups. The optimal time to act is when the cost of content delays exceeds AI implementation costs, typically when opportunity costs exceed $5,000 monthly.
